Output 6421a82f5f731e4766b9232eaa72d6185f1352e8c7a015efd867ce1e1254ea9c:0

value
1258880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3ce7a2b41f3bdeef8aed2900b2e57437752488e OP_EQUAL
address
3Pv9USuZhKvDnenV9j1hM8XnSyPaWvZfmt
transaction
6421a82f5f731e4766b9232eaa72d6185f1352e8c7a015efd867ce1e1254ea9c
confirmations
155868
spent
true